CheckedListBox.CheckedIndexCollection.IList.Contains(Object) Method

Determines whether the specified index is located within the CheckedListBox.CheckedIndexCollection. For a description of this member, see Contains(Object).
virtual bool System.Collections.IList.Contains(System::Object ^ index) = System::Collections::IList::Contains;
bool IList.Contains (object index);
bool IList.Contains (object? index);
abstract member System.Collections.IList.Contains : obj -> bool
override this.System.Collections.IList.Contains : obj -> bool
Function Contains (index As Object) As Boolean Implements IList.Contains
Parameters
- index
- Object
The index to locate in the collection.
Returns
true
if the specified index from the CheckedListBox.ObjectCollection for the CheckedListBox is an item in this collection; otherwise, false
.
Implements
Remarks
This member is an explicit interface member implementation. It can be used only when the CheckedListBox.CheckedIndexCollection instance is cast to an IList interface.
